Tarn is an inland administrative region in Occitanie, France, known for its rolling countryside, historic towns, and river landscapes rather than open-ocean diving. The region’s proximity to the coast is limited; true saltwater diving is not a defining feature of Tarn itself. While nearby coastal areas along the Balearic Sea offer Mediterranean dives, Tarn’s dive scene is primarily inland and freshwater-focused, with opportunities to explore rivers and man-made reservoirs in the broader Occitanie area. For divers planning trips, consider combining cultural tourism in Castres, Albi, and Gaillac with short excursions to coastal dive hubs in southern France.
